20071019 · Gas dispersion is the collective term for superficial gas (air) velocity (or gas rate, volumetric air flow rate per unit cross-sectional area of cell, Jg ), gas-holdup (volumetric fraction of gas in a gas–slurry mix, εg ), and bubble size distribution ( Db ). view more2008121 · Mineral flotation in mechanically agitated vessels (cells) involves complex interaction between bubbles, particles and the liquid phase. Ideally, just enough power input from the impeller is needed to so that the frequency of particle–bubble collision and attachment is maximised, while at the same time detachment events are minimised.
